2025年3月26日 星期三 甲辰(龙)年 月廿五 设为首页 加入收藏
rss
您当前的位置:首页 > 计算机 > 软件应用 > 数据库 > 其它数据库

sql创建并循环临时表

时间:12-04来源:作者:点击数:22

在SQL中,可以使用以下语法创建临时表并进行循环操作:

  • -- 创建临时表
  • CREATE TEMPORARY TABLE temp_table (
  • column1 datatype1,
  • column2 datatype2,
  • ...
  • );
  • -- 循环插入数据
  • WHILE condition
  • DO
  • -- 插入数据到临时表
  • INSERT INTO temp_table (column1, column2, ...)
  • VALUES (value1, value2, ...);
  • -- 更新循环条件
  • SET condition = ...; -- 根据实际情况更新循环条件
  • END WHILE;
  • -- 使用临时表的数据进行其他操作
  • SELECT * FROM temp_table;
  • -- 删除临时表
  • DROP TABLE temp_table;

上述示例代码创建了一个名为temp_table的临时表,然后使用WHILE循环语句向临时表中插入数据,直到满足循环条件停止。在循环结束后,可以使用临时表中的数据执行其他操作,如查询数据。最后,通过DROP TABLE语句删除临时表。

临时表的创建和使用方式可能因数据库管理系统(如MySQL、SQL Server等)而有所不同。在实际使用时,请根据所使用的数据库管理系统的语法规范进行相应的调整。

方便获取更多学习、工作、生活信息请关注本站微信公众号城东书院 微信服务号城东书院 微信订阅号
推荐内容
相关内容
栏目更新
栏目热门